Ambassador of Palestine, Tunisian envoy discuss matters of mutual interest
ISLAMABAD, JAN 29 (DNA) – Palestinian Ambassador to Pakistan Ahmed Rabei met Tunisian Ambassador at the Tunisian embassy in Islamabad.
The conditions in Tunisia were reassured, and Ambassador Ahmed Rabei wished stability, security and prosperity to Tunisia and the Tunisian people.
The situation in Palestine, the upcoming elections, the two ambassadors exchanged cordial conversations and the common relations between the two embassies.=DNA
